Abstract

Existing technologies to encapsulate Multi-Protocol Label Switching (MPLS) over IP are not adequate for efficient load balancing of MPLS application traffic, such as MPLS-based Layer2 Virtual Private Network (L2VPN) or Layer3 Virtual Private Network (L3VPN) traffic across IP networks. This document specifies additional IP-based encapsulation technology, referred to as MPLS-in-User Datagram Protocol (UDP), which can facilitate the load balancing of MPLS application traffic across IP networks.
